7FP7FP--European Research project European Research project SMooHS SMooHS -- Smart Monitoring of Historic Structures

www.smoohs.euwww.smoohs.eu

Scientific Leader: Prof. Giovanni PascaleWP5 Leader: Dr. Camilla CollaHead Research Unit: Prof. Francesco UbertiniMain tasks of UNIBO:WP4: modelling of masonry deterioration, coupled models, data fusionWP5: integrated NDT and mechanical testing of structural elements,

comparative testing, lab accelerated ageing tests on masonry WP6: case problem definition (Palazzo Malvezzi), structural modelling

and model coupling, NDT tests on stones and wooden elements

WP4: Coupled mechanical - environmental deterioration modelling of brick masonry walls

WP5: Lab. testing of defects and

decay on wooden samples and

masonry specimens

7FP – Theme 6 Environment, Project-Number: 212939

Duration: 3 years (started date: 2008-12-01), 14 PartnerTotal EC contribution: € 1,404,993.00, UNIBO (DISTART) Budget: € 190,200.00

WP6: 3 main case studies (in Berlin, Schwäbisch Gmünd and Bologna) are used to demonstrate and validate the work that is done in the core WP. 2 additional test sites (in Hebron and Vienna) serve for method and system enhancement.

Aim: establish smart monitoring systems based on wireless sensors that are inexpensive,

robusts and can support the preservationists

7FP7FP--European Research projectEuropean Research project3EN-CULT Efficient ENergy for EU Cultural Heritage22 partner

Main tasks of UNIBO: -analysis and diagnosis of problematics of historical buildings as support to decision on best solutions -evaluation of intervention measures adopted as expost quality control on building modelling of specific environmental risks due to moisture, salt content in CS -responsible for CS n. 3 (Palazzina della Viola, Bologna, Italy).

Duration: 42 months (started date: 2010-10-01)Total Requested EC contribution: € 4,990,485.00

Aim: support the sustainable refurbishment of Europe’s built heritage through the development and demonstration of new

systems and technologies both for “hard facts” energy efficient building concept and “soft systems”, such as the intelligent

monitoring & control system..
